Performance breakdown
Durability
Heavy-duty stoneware construction withstands daily wear and tear with ease.
Versatility
Wide-mouth design transitions seamlessly from morning coffee to hearty soups.
Aesthetic Appeal
Iconic blue floral pattern delivers a timeless, rustic farmhouse charm.
Ergonomics
Sturdy side handle provides a secure grip, though weight is substantial.
Heat Retention
Thick stoneware walls keep liquids and broths warm for extended periods.
Collectibility
Highly sought-after vintage pattern perfect for completing existing dinnerware sets.
